Gift Registry

REGISTRY ESSENTIALS

DINNERWARE

Shop Now

FLATWARE

Shop Now

DRINKWARE

Shop Now

CRYSTAL

Shop Now

FIND YOUR DINNERWARE STYLE

FINE CHINA

Shop Now

BONE CHINA

Shop Now

EVERYDAY

Shop Now

THE PERFECT GIFT

GIFTWARE

Shop Now
h1.page-template__title {display: none;} #RegistryPg h3 { color: #5f9bc4; text-align: center; padding-top: 30px; font-size: 4em;} #RegistryPg .borderTop {border-top: solid 1px #ccc; max-width: 986px; margin: 0 auto;} #RegistryPg .oneColumnWidth {max-width: 986px !important;} #RegistryPg .padTop {padding-top: 48px !important;} #RegistryPg .noPadBtm {padding-bottom: 0 !important;} #RegistryPg .about-two-column-single-container { width: 100%; display: flex; flex-direction: column; max-width: 498px; align-items: center; justify-content: center; text-align: center; margin-top: 0; margin-bottom: 32px; } #RegistryPg .about-outer-two-column-image-container { display: flex; justify-content: center; width: 100%; max-width: 470px; } #RegistryPg .about-three-columns-main-container { padding-top: 0px; padding-bottom: 48px; } #RegistryPg .about-three-columns-inner-container { display: flex; flex-direction: column; align-items: center; justify-content: center; padding-right: 16px; padding-left: 16px; } #RegistryPg .about-three-columns-header-container { margin-bottom: 32px; text-align: center; } #RegistryPg .about-three-columns-content-container { display: flex; flex-direction: column; width: 100%; align-items: center; } #RegistryPg .about-three-column-single-container { width: 100%; display: flex; flex-direction: column; max-width: 416px; align-items: center; justify-content: center; text-align: center; margin-top: 0; margin-bottom: 32px; } #RegistryPg .about-outer-column-image-container { display: flex; justify-content: center; width: 100%; max-width: 400px; } #RegistryPg .about-three-column-single-image-container { width: 300px; height: 300px !important; background-size: cover; } #RegistryPg .about-three-column-single-header { margin-bottom: 30px; } #RegistryPg .about-three-column-single-copy { font-size: 12px; line-height: 20px; max-width: 416px; } #RegistryPg .about-three-column-cta { margin-top: 16px; text-align: center; padding: 0; } #RegistryPg .ButtonBox { background: #5f9bc4; border: #5f9bc4; color: #fff; opacity: 1; cursor: pointer; display: inline-block; text-align: center; transition: .3s ease all; text-decoration: none; white-space: nowrap; outline: 0; overflow: hidden; position: relative; border: 0; font-size: 0; height: 44px; min-width: 160px; text-align: center; -webkit-user-select: none; -moz-user-select: none; -ms-user-select: none; user-select: none; font-family: "brandon-grotesque",serif; font-weight: 500; border-radius: 2px; } @media (min-width: 1024px) { #RegistryPg .about-three-columns-inner-container { max-width: 1400px; margin-left: auto; margin-right: auto; padding-left: 30px; padding-right: 30px; } #RegistryPg .about-three-columns-header-container { margin-bottom: 40px; } #RegistryPg .about-three-columns-content-container { flex-direction: row; align-items: flex-start; justify-content: space-between; } #RegistryPg .about-three-column-single-container { max-width: 416px; } #RegistryPg .about-three-column-single-image-container { padding: 0; } #RegistryPg .about-three-column-single-copy { font-size: 16px; line-height: 22px; max-width: 290px; } } @media (max-width: 767px) { /* #RegistryPg .about-three-column-single-image-container { height: 256px !important;} */ #RegistryPg h3 {font-size: 2.5em;} #RegistryPg .about-three-column-single-header {font-size: 1.8em;} #RegistryPg .about-three-columns-main-container {padding-bottom: 0px;} #RegistryPg .padTop {padding-top: 10px !important;} }@media (max-width: 1023px) and (min-width: 768px) { #RegistryPg h3 {font-size: 3.5em;} }